Understanding the Mechanics of the Aviator Game
The fundamental principle behind aviator is deceptively straightforward. A new round begins with a virtual airplane taking off from the left side of the screen. As it ascends, a multiplier increases steadily. This multiplier directly correlates to the potential profit a player can realize. The objective is to cash out before the plane disappears from view. If a player cashes out before the plane vanishes, their initial bet is multiplied by the current multiplier. However, if the plane flies away before the player cashes out, the bet is lost. The key to the experience lies in predicting when the plane will crash, or opting for a safe, smaller profit early on.
The random number generator (RNG) dictates when the plane flies away, ensuring fairness and unpredictability. Each round is independent, meaning previous results have no bearing on future outcomes. This is a crucial point for players to understand – there are no guaranteed patterns or strategies that can consistently beat the system. Instead, players must rely on assessing risk, implementing sound betting practices, and often, a certain degree of intuition. The game typically offers features like auto-cashout, which allows players to pre-set a multiplier at which their bet will automatically be cashed out, mitigating the risk of losing their stake due to hesitation or connection issues. The user interface also often displays the betting history of other players, providing a social element and potential insights – though these should be treated with caution.
The variations in multipliers are typically quite large, ranging from 1x to potentially hundreds or even thousands of times the initial bet. This is where the temptation comes in – the allure of a huge payout. However, the higher the multiplier, the lower the probability of the plane reaching that point. Understanding this correlation is fundamental to responsible gameplay. Developing Strategic Approaches to Aviator Gameplay
While aviator is predominantly a game of chance, incorporating strategic thinking can significantly enhance the player experience and potentially improve results. One popular strategy is the “single bet” approach, where a player places a single bet per round and aims to consistently cash out at a specific multiplier, such as 1.5x or 2x. This method prioritizes consistent, smaller profits over the pursuit of larger, riskier payouts. Another strategy involves using the auto-cashout feature to secure profits at predetermined multipliers, thereby eliminating emotional decision-making and preventing the loss of funds due to hesitation. A more aggressive approach is the “Martingale” system, where players double their bet after each loss, with the intention of recouping all previous losses with a single win. However, the Martingale system is inherently risky, as it requires a substantial bankroll and can lead to significant losses if a losing streak persists.
A crucial aspect of strategy is bankroll management. Players should determine a budget for their aviator sessions and adhere to it strictly. Never bet more than a small percentage of the bankroll on a single bet. Additionally, it's wise to set win and loss limits. When the win limit is reached, it's time to stop playing and enjoy the profits. Similarly, when the loss limit is reached, it’s essential to step away from the game to avoid chasing losses and further depleting the bankroll. Carefully considering your risk tolerance is paramount. Are you comfortable with the possibility of losing your entire stake for a chance at a potentially large payout? Or do you prefer a more conservative approach focused on smaller, more frequent wins?

The Psychology of Aviator: Managing Emotions and Risk
Aviator is not merely a mathematical exercise; it’s a psychologically engaging game. The thrill of watching the plane ascend and the anticipation of a large multiplier can be intensely exciting, but it can also lead to impulsive decision-making. The fear of missing out (FOMO) is a common phenomenon, where players hesitate to cash out at a reasonable multiplier, hoping for an even higher payout, only to see the plane fly away. Similarly, the desire to recoup losses can lead to increasingly reckless betting, a behavior known as “chasing losses.” Managing these emotions is crucial for successful aviator gameplay.
Developing a disciplined mindset is essential. Stick to the pre-defined betting strategy and bankroll management plan, regardless of short-term wins or losses. Avoid making impulsive decisions based on emotional impulses. Treat aviator as a form of entertainment, not as a source of income. Recognizing that losses are an inherent part of the game and accepting them gracefully is vital for maintaining a healthy attitude. Taking regular breaks is also important to prevent mental fatigue and maintain focus. Remember, the goal is to enjoy the experience responsibly, not to relentlessly pursue profits at all costs.

Understanding the cognitive biases that can influence decision-making is also important. The “gambler’s fallacy” is the belief that past events affect future probabilities. The RNG ensures each round is independent, so previous results have no bearing on the next outcome. Being aware of these biases can help players make more rational and informed decisions.
